1. Cavitation in pumps occurs when local fluid pressure drops below:
The vapor pressure of the fluid

Cavitation occurs when local static pressure falls below the fluid's vapor pressure, causing vapor bubble formation and collapse.

2. The effectiveness-NTU method in heat exchanger analysis defines effectiveness as:
Ratio of actual heat transfer to maximum possible heat transfer

Effectiveness ε = Q_actual / Q_max, where Q_max is the heat transferred if one fluid underwent the maximum possible temperature change.

3. The primary purpose of a secondary wastewater treatment process is to:
Biologically remove dissolved organic matter using microorganisms

Secondary treatment (activated sludge, trickling filters) uses biological processes to degrade dissolved and suspended organic matter after primary settling.

4. The Reynolds number for flow in a pipe transitions from laminar to turbulent at approximately:
Re = 2300

For pipe flow, laminar conditions persist below Re ≈ 2300, with transition to turbulence occurring between 2300 and 4000.

5. Dynamic viscosity has SI units of:
Pa·s

Dynamic (absolute) viscosity μ has SI units of Pascal-seconds (Pa·s), equivalent to N·s/m² or kg/(m·s).

6. Which type of stress causes shear failure along a 45° plane in a uniaxially loaded ductile member?
Maximum shear stress

Maximum shear stress on planes at 45° to the principal stress axes causes slip and shear failure in ductile materials under uniaxial loading.
